[Management of posttraumatic ocular hypotony].

Posttraumatic ocular hypotony, a serious complication after eye injuries, can cause vision loss. Prompt diagnosis and targeted treatment, like cycloplegic therapy or surgery, are crucial for preserving the eye.

Background:
- Posttraumatic ocular hypotony occurs after ocular contusion or open globe injury, potentially leading to severe secondary eyeball damage.
- Complications include corneal folds, ciliary body and choroidal detachment, papilledema, macular folds, and visual impairment.
- Contralateral ocular hypertension can also occur.
Purpose of the Study:
- To outline the causes, consequences, and management strategies for posttraumatic ocular hypotony.
- To emphasize the importance of identifying and treating the underlying cause of hypotony for globe preservation.
Main Methods:
- Review of posttraumatic ocular hypotony, focusing on cyclodialysis as a common cause.
- Discussion of treatment options based on the size of the cyclodialysis cleft, including cycloplegic treatment and surgical interventions.
- Exploration of alternative surgical approaches such as silicone oil endotamponade or Schlemm's canal occlusion.
Main Results:
- Globe preservation is possible if over 210° of the ciliary body remains intact.
- Smaller cyclodialysis clefts may resolve with cycloplegic treatment.
- Larger clefts necessitate surgical repair, potentially combined with other procedures.
Conclusions:
- Posttraumatic ocular hypotony is a complex condition requiring precise diagnostics.
- Causal and specific treatment is essential for managing hypotony and preventing further ocular damage.
- Timely intervention improves the chances of preserving ocular integrity and visual function.
